    We had mutual friends and I found him to be an extremely accommodating and friendly person to random fans who would come up and interrupt what he was doing. He always called people friendly things, like "guy" as if he knew them.

    What's funny is that he was always on the "most overrated" lists but consider that he played not to get stats! When he came in, I remember it was a rough start (think he was ejected from his first game) and there was a story in the paper a couple of years later where either Ron Lynn or Mike Haluchak was talking about how they convinced him after that game to be the all around linebacker he was and they told him that he was going to be the greatest in the history of the game. Because that first year, fans were initially really pissed off that he wasn't just set free on quarterbacks. So that he got as much credit as he does without all the sacks, pretty much proves how awesome he was. I don't have statistics to show but he solo blitzed on runs a lot and dropped a lot of backs for losses (funny those don't count as much in fans' views) but that wasn't even his only thing--He just owned the game in every way. But it's true...if he was lined up to be the one dimensional Lawrence Taylor, he would have been that
